Zagreb and Tokyo - Airport Transportation

Zagreb International Airport (ZAG)

How to Get to the Airport

Bus 290 (ZET): You can reach the airport from Kvaternikov Trg with the same bus line. The journey takes 35 minutes, and services run every 35 minutes.


Shuttle Bus (Pleso Prijevoz): Transportation to the airport from the Zagreb Central Bus Terminal is possible with a shuttle. The journey, which takes 30-40 minutes, is available with services every 30 minutes. The shuttle operates between 04:00-00:00.


Taxi: You can reach the airport from the city center by calling a taxi or using an app. The journey time varies between 25-40 minutes. Taxi service is uninterrupted 24/7.


Car Rental: You can return to the airport with the car you rented in the city center. The journey takes about 20-30 minutes depending on traffic. You can return the vehicle to the car rental offices.

Haneda Airport (HND)

From Airport to City Center

Tokyo Monorail: You can reach Hamamatsucho Station directly by taking the Tokyo Monorail from Terminals 1, 2, and 3 of Haneda Airport. From there, you can transfer to the JR Yamanote Line for easy access to central areas of Tokyo, such as Tokyo Station, Shinjuku, or Shibuya. Monorail services are frequent and regular.


Keikyu Airport Line: The Keikyu Line provides direct access from Haneda to Shinagawa Station, allowing transfers to the JR Yamanote Line or Shinkansen. It is a practical option for those wishing to travel to Tokyo Station from Shinagawa.


Limousine Bus (Airport Bus): Limousine Buses departing from Haneda Airport operate to various destinations such as Tokyo Station, Ginza, and Shibuya. The buses follow different routes, stopping at multiple hotels and stations.


Taxi: Official taxi stands can be found at the exits of the airport terminals. Taxis provide transportation to locations like Ginza, Tokyo Station, and Shibuya, depending on traffic. They also operate after midnight.


Private Transfer / VIP Vehicle: Private vehicle transfer services are available to hotels in Tokyo's 23 districts. Luxurious vehicle options and chauffeur services offer a comfortable travel experience.

Narita International Airport (NRT)

From Airport to City Center

Metro/Train: The JR Narita Express (N'EX) line provides direct access from Narita Airport to central points like Tokyo Station, Shibuya, and Shinjuku. The journey takes approximately 60 minutes. Services run every 30 minutes and operate from 07:37 AM to 09:44 PM.


Keisei Skyliner Train: Offers fast access from Narita Airport to Keisei Ueno or Nippori stations. The journey takes approximately 36-45 minutes. Services are scheduled every 30 minutes and run throughout the day.


JR Sobu Line Train: Operates as a commuter train to Tokyo Station. The journey takes approximately 80-90 minutes with services every 30 minutes. It operates from early to late hours.


Bus: Various bus lines provide transportation from Narita Airport to the Tokyo area. Travel time and frequency vary by line.


Taxi: Taxis are available at the airport terminal exits. Travel to Tokyo city center can take approximately 60-90 minutes, depending on traffic conditions.
